Engineering 9 min watch

Build boring software

When trying to solve a problem, it can be tempting to build a sophisticated, elegant and complex solution. But that unnecessary complexity can lead to just as complicated issues. We think boring software is better, and here’s why.

Product & Design 1 min read

Often in software you’ll hear that you get something for free, like “the framework just gives us this for free.” But you’ll quickly discover there is always a cost, because nothing is ever “free” in software.